Gamida Cell is a leader in advanced cellular therapies and hematopoietic stem cell transplants, with two FDA approved therapies, Omisirge® (omidubicel-onlv) and APHEXDA® (motixafortide). Omisirge® is the first and only FDA approved cell therapy for allogeneic stem cell transplant. APHEXDA® is a stem cell mobilization agent indicated for autologous transplantation for patients with multiple myeloma.
General Scope and Summary
The Sr. Business Analyst role is an integral role to Gamida Cell and will be responsible for the operational execution of commercial analytics, reporting, forecasting support, data governance, incentive compensation, CRM data stewardship, and business capabilities. This individual will serve as the primary operation owner of the commercial analytics ecosystem and partner closely with Commercial, Market Access, Finance, Patient Services, Cell Therapy Operations, and IT to improve decision making, increase data integrity, enhance reporting capabilities, and support commercial growth objectives. The successful candidate will create scalable processes and reporting capabilities while ensuring that commercial leadership has timely, accurate, and actionable insights to support business decisions. This role will report directly to the Sr. Director, Pricing & Analytics. This role’s key responsibilities will be managing internal KPI reporting, supporting data model strategies and integrations, deep dive analytics, forecasting revenue and demand, and helping to collect data to inform strategic and tactical decisions. This requires strategic thinking, communication skills, along with various technical data analytics capabilities as well as the ability to work cross-functionally to understand the business in-depth.
